WebFeb 22, 2016 · A: You could be convicted of the crime of unlawful possession of a firearm, which is a class B felony under Washington law. You could also lose your job, if you work in a setting – such as a military base – where a gun offense on your record would preclude employment. The statute that applies is RCW 941.040. WebSigned declaration: This document certifies that you meet the requirements for restoring under firearm rights under RCW 9.41.040(4). You must sign this document under penalty of perjury. Proposed Order: This is the most important document—the document that you're hoping the Court will sign, restoring your firearm rights.

WebUnder RCW 9.41.040 (4)b), you must file your petition to restore your firearms in one of these two courts: The "court of record" that took away your firearm rights.
